Nalayh weather in June

In June, Nalayh sees average daytime highs of 20°C and overnight lows near 8°C, with 54 mm of precipitation across 9.8 wet days and about 15.7 hours of daylight. It is the 2nd-warmest and 3rd-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 18°C in the first days to 21°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 27% of the time in June,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 15 h 30 min at the start of June to 15 h 48 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, June is Nalayh's 12th-clearest and 4th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Nalayh's year-round climate.

Location & terrain

Where is Nalayh?

Nalayh sits at 47.8°N, 107.3°E, 1,434 m above sea level, in Mongolia. The nearest listed city is Zuunmod, 26 km away.

Topography around Nalayh

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Nalayh.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Nalayh has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 148 m around an average of 1,450 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 743 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,674 m.

The land around Nalayh is covered by grassland (72%) and artificial surfaces (21%) within 3 km, grassland (89%) within 16 km, and grassland (82%) within 80 km.
